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

Domestic Students

You must meet ONE of the following requirements:
  • Completed Certificate III in Seed Testing or equivalent qualifications

More about Certificate IV in Seed Testing

Embarking on a career in seed testing can lead to a variety of rewarding job opportunities, particularly in Bacchus Marsh, where the agricultural sector thrives. The Certificate IV in Seed Testing equips students with essential knowledge and skills, paving the way for roles such as Quality Controller, Laboratory Technician, and Seed Technician. This qualification not only enhances employability but also ensures that graduates are adept in testing procedures that are vital to the industry.
